Output 59ccfa9e07e8c3eb0aa23f1637a24ea4f7621241ade7221a82ee108dae60bb0a:1

value
35320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8dc8b4d4e173e1683c136b0753c46fabebb3da7 OP_EQUAL
address
3NvGtiyQGLm8H8fgWLBc8HKBroTCBQDUgK
transaction
59ccfa9e07e8c3eb0aa23f1637a24ea4f7621241ade7221a82ee108dae60bb0a
spent
true